Position Overview:
TheΒ HR Shared Services Analyst plays a key role in the delivery of scalable, high-quality HR support across the employee lifecycle. This position combines hands-on case management, process execution, and knowledge article maintenance with a focus on identifying trends and driving operational improvements.
The Shared Services Analyst is a key team member responsible for managing complex HR processes; including ownership and management of Verra Mobilityβs immigration program; serving as the primary liaison between internal stakeholders, employees, and external legal counsel. This role ensures compliance, consistency, and a positive experience throughout the sponsorship process.
The ideal candidate is organized, data-driven, and brings a continuous improvement mindset to enhance processes and employee support. They are comfortable navigating ambiguity, working independently, and serving as a connector between employees and HR subject matter experts.
Success in this role requires attention to detail, a high level of discretion when handling sensitive employee information, and a proactive, solution-oriented approach to challenges. This role supports both day-to-day employee needs as well as strategy HR initiatives and is a critical contributor to ensuring excellence in the support experience. This role reports to the Manager of HR Shared Services and is part of the centralized HR Technology and Operations team.
Essential Responsibilities:
- Support the implementation of a new Case Management system and Knowledge Article workspace in Workday, ensuring a seamless experience for both internal HR users and all employees through training, documentation, and process alignment.
- Own the end-to-end coordination of the U.S. immigration process (including PERM, H-1B, and green card filings) by serving as the primary liaison between employees, managers, external immigration counsel, and internal legal and HR partners.
- Maintain and track immigration records, case statuses, deadlines, and required documentation.
- Serve as the first point of contact for employee inquiries, resolving Tier 1 HR cases with a high level of customer service, accuracy, and consistency. Triage, escalate, or reassign inquiries as appropriate to Tier 2 HR Centers of Excellence.
- Identify trends across HR Service data and recommend process or documentation improvements and implement solutions to drive greater efficiency and employee satisfaction.
- Create and maintain content in the employee-facing knowledge base, ensuring content is clear, relevant, and aligned with current processes.
- Collaborate with internal HR stakeholders to stay informed of policy, process, or system changes that impact employee self-service and partner with cross-functional teams to ensure HR operations are completed accurately and efficiently.
- Maintain documentation and support compliance activities, including audits, reporting, employment eligibility verification, and unemployment claims processing.
- Participate in cross-functional projects or improvement initiatives related to HR systems, tools, or support models.
- Ensure sensitive employee information is handled with discretion and in alignment with data privacy policies.
- Ensure compliance with internal controls and data integrity standards.
Qualifications:
2-4 years of experience in HR Shared Services, HR Operations, HR Coordinator or related roles, ideally within a global organization.
Hands-on experience managing U.S. immigration processes or working closely with immigration legal counsel required.
Working knowledge of HR systems and tools.
- Workday experience strongly preferred.
Excellent communication and interpersonal skills; able to interact professionally with employees at all levels.
Strong organizational skills and attention to detail; able to manage multiple workflows independently and prioritize effectively.
Skilled at writing and maintaining clear, concise, and user-friendly HR content, technical guides, and employee resources.
High level of integrity and discretion in handling confidential information.
Proficient with Microsoft Office Suite (Outlook, Word, Excel, Teams, OneNote, etc.).
